Advertisement
Guest User

Untitled

a guest
Aug 12th, 2017
519
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 7.79 KB | None | 0 0
  1. <html>
  2. <head>
  3. <link rel="stylesheet" type="text/css" href="css/template.css" />
  4. <meta http-equiv="Content-Type" content="text/html; charset=ISO-8859-1" />
  5. <link rel="stylesheet" type="text/css" href="tinybox/style.css" />
  6. <script type="text/javascript" src="tinybox/tinybox.js"></script>
  7. <script type="text/javascript" src="tinymce/jscripts/tiny_mce/tiny_mce.js"></script>
  8. <link rel="stylesheet" type="text/css" media="all" href="datepicker/jsDatePick_ltr.min.css" />
  9. <script type="text/javascript" src="datepicker/jsDatePick.min.1.3.js"></script>
  10.  
  11. <script type="text/javascript">
  12. function deleteRow(rowid){
  13.  
  14. var delrow = document.getElementById(rowid).parentNode;
  15. delrow.removeChild(document.getElementById(rowid));
  16.  
  17. }
  18.  
  19.  
  20.  
  21. function addEmailRow(count){
  22.  
  23. var table = document.getElementById('emailtable');
  24.  
  25. row=parent.document.createElement('tr');
  26.  
  27. if(count % 2 != 1){
  28. var class="folderodd";
  29. }else{
  30. var class="foldereven";
  31. }
  32. row.style.verticalAlign='middle';
  33. row.className=class;
  34.  
  35.  
  36. //CELL 1
  37. cell1 =parent.document.createElement('td');
  38. inp = parent.document.createElement('input');
  39. inp.type ='text';
  40. inp.name = 'voornaamnaam'+count;
  41. inp.size='25';
  42. cell1.height="40px";
  43.  
  44. cell1.appendChild(inp);
  45.  
  46. //CELL 2
  47. cell2 =parent.document.createElement('td');
  48. inp = parent.document.createElement('input');
  49. inp.type ='text';
  50. inp.name = 'email'+count;
  51. inp.size='27';
  52.  
  53. cell2.appendChild(inp);
  54.  
  55. //CELL 3
  56. cell3 =parent.document.createElement('td');
  57.  
  58.  
  59. //CELL 4
  60. cell4 =parent.document.createElement('td');
  61. cell4.style.textAlign="center";
  62.  
  63. newlink = document.createElement('a');
  64. newlink.setAttribute('name', 'Example');
  65.  
  66. newlink.setAttribute('onClick', 'deleteRow("r'+count+'")');
  67. newlink.setAttribute('border', '0');
  68. var img = new Image();
  69. img.src = "images/delete.png";
  70. img.setAttribute('border', '0');
  71. newlink.appendChild(img);
  72. cell4.appendChild(newlink);
  73.  
  74. row.appendChild(cell1);
  75. row.appendChild(cell2);
  76. row.appendChild(cell3);
  77. row.appendChild(cell4);
  78. row.id = 'r'+count;
  79.  
  80. row.height="50";
  81.  
  82. /*table.appendChild(row);*/
  83. var tb = document.getElementById('tablebody');
  84. tb.insertBefore(row, tb.rows[0]);
  85.  
  86. }
  87.  
  88. function validateForm(){
  89.  
  90. var titel = document.getElementById('uname');
  91. var username = document.getElementById('jusername');
  92. var ret = true;
  93. var val,row;
  94.  
  95. var error ="";
  96.  
  97. titel.style.border="1px solid #ff4e00";
  98. username.style.border="1px solid #ff4e00";
  99.  
  100. if(titel.value.length == 0){
  101.  
  102. titel.style.border='2px solid red';
  103. error = error+"<li>Gelieve een groepnaam in te vullen</li> ";
  104. ret = false;
  105. }
  106.  
  107. if(username.value.length == 0){
  108.  
  109. error =error+ "<li>Gelieve een loginnaam in te vullen</li> ";
  110. username.style.border='2px solid red';
  111. ret = false;
  112. }
  113.  
  114. for(var i=0; i<document.userform.elements.length; i++)
  115. {
  116. if(document.userform.elements[i].name !='uname' && document.userform.elements[i].name !='jusername'){
  117.  
  118. document.userform.elements[i].style.border="1px solid #ff4e00";
  119.  
  120. if(document.userform.elements[i].type=='text' && document.userform.elements[i].value.length == 0){
  121.  
  122. if(document.userform.elements[i].name.indexOf('voornaamnaam') != -1){
  123. error=error+"<li>Gelieve een voornaam en naam in te vullen</li>";
  124. document.userform.elements[i].style.border='2px solid red';
  125. }
  126. else if(document.userform.elements[i].name.indexOf('email') != -1){
  127. error=error+"<li>Gelieve een e-mailadres in te vullen</li>";
  128. document.userform.elements[i].style.border='2px solid red';
  129. }
  130.  
  131.  
  132. ret = false;
  133. }
  134. else if(document.userform.elements[i].type=='text' && document.userform.elements[i].value.length > 0
  135. && document.userform.elements[i].name.indexOf('email') != -1){
  136. email = document.userform.elements[i].value
  137. AtPos = email.indexOf("@")
  138. StopPos = email.lastIndexOf(".")
  139.  
  140. if (email == "") {
  141. error =error+ "<li>Gelieve een correct e-mailadres in te vullen</li>";
  142. }
  143.  
  144. if (AtPos == -1 || StopPos == -1) {
  145. error =error+ "<li>Gelieve een correct e-mailadres in te vullen</li>";
  146. }
  147.  
  148. if (StopPos < AtPos) {
  149. error =error+ "<li>Gelieve een correct e-mailadres in te vullen</li>";
  150. }
  151.  
  152. if (StopPos - AtPos == 1) {
  153. error =error+ "<li>Gelieve een correct e-mailadres in te vullen</li>";
  154. }
  155. }
  156. }
  157. }
  158. if(error.length > 0){
  159. error = "<ul style='color:red;font-weight:bold;'>"+error+"</ul>";
  160.  
  161. TINY.box.show(error,0,0,0,1,1.9);
  162. }
  163.  
  164. return ret;
  165. }
  166. </script>
  167. </head>
  168. <body bgcolor="#ffffff" id="tinybody2">
  169.  
  170. <script type="text/javascript">
  171. function hideChild(){
  172. TINY.box.hide();
  173. setTimeout("showSuccess()", 1000);
  174.  
  175. }
  176. function showSuccess(){
  177. TINY.box.show('<table width="400" height="110"><tr rowspan="2"><td width="100"><img src="images/success.png" width="100"/></td><td width="*"><span class="successmsg">E-mail verstuurd</span></td><td width="32" valign="top"><a href="javascript:parent.window.location.reload();"><img src="images/close.png" border="0" width="30" height="30"/></a></td></tr></table>',0,0,0,1,1.5);
  178. }
  179. </script><div class="popupwgrouptitle"><p id="popuptitle">Webgroep: <b>Vrijwilligers</b></p></div><hr id="titlehrpopup"><br/><form action="viewwebgrouppopup.php" method="post" name="userform" onSubmit="return validateForm()">
  180. <div id="subsubcontentpopupwgroup">
  181.  
  182. <table width="600" style="line-height:30px;margin-left:20px;">
  183. <tr>
  184. <td width="100">
  185. <p class="name">Webgroepnaam: </p>
  186.  
  187. </td><td width="500">
  188. <p id="messagetablerowvalp"><input type="text" size="40" id="uname" name="uname" value="Vrijwilligers"></p> </td>
  189. </tr><tr>
  190. <td width="200">
  191. <p class="name">Loginnaam: </p>
  192. </td><td width="400">
  193. <p id="messagetablerowvalp"><input type="text" size="20" id="jusername" name="jusername" READONLY value="vrijwilligers"></p></td>
  194. </tr><tr>
  195.  
  196. <td width="200">
  197. <p class="name">Wachtwoord: </p>
  198. </td><td width="400">
  199. <p id="messagetablerowvalp">
  200. <input type="text" size="15" id="password" name="password" READONLY value="qdamG7wLG"></p>
  201. </td>
  202. </tr>
  203.  
  204. </table><table class="documenttable" style="width:670px !important;line-height:30px;margin-left:20px;" id="emailtable"><thead><tr class="msgcatinfoheader"><td width="40%" class="documenttitle">Voornaam en naam</td>
  205.  
  206. <td width="40%">E-mailadres</td>
  207. <td width="10%"></td>
  208. <td width="10%"></td>
  209.  
  210. </tr></thead><tbody id="tablebody"><tr class="foldereven"><td valign="middle">
  211. <p id="messagetablerowvalp" style="padding-left:10px" >
  212. freddy
  213. </td><td valign="middle" style="padding-left:10px">
  214. <p id="messagetablerowvalp" >
  215. freddy@yahoo.com
  216. </td><td valign="middle" align="center"><a href="#" id="sendfreddy106freddy@yahoo.com">
  217. <img src="images/postuit.png" border="0"/>
  218.  
  219. </a><script type="text/javascript">T$('sendfreddy106freddy@yahoo.com').onclick = function(){TINY.box.show('sendwebdocmailpopupframe.php?id=106&login=vrijwilligers&email=freddy@yahoo.com&webgroupname=Vrijwilligers&pass=qdamG7wLG',200,680,370,1)}</script> </td><td width="20" valign="middle" align="center">
  220. <a href="#" id="delete1">
  221. <img src="images/delete.png" border="0"/>
  222. </a><script type="text/javascript">T$('delete1').onclick = function(){TINY.box.show('deletepopup.php?type=webgroupemail&objectid=106&voornaamnaam=freddy&email=freddy@yahoo.com',200,600,200,1)}</script> </td></tr></tbody></table><input type="hidden" name="webgroupid" value="106">
  223. </table>
  224.  
  225. </div>
  226.  
  227. <table width="400" style="margin-left:20px;margin-top:-10px;display:inline;float:left;">
  228.  
  229. <tr>
  230. <td>
  231. <a href="#" class="addemailaddress" onClick="javascript:addEmailRow('2');">
  232. <img src="images/plus.png" border="0"/>Nieuwe webgroepgebruiker toevoegen
  233. </a>
  234. </td>
  235. </tr>
  236. </table>
  237. <div id="nextbuttonwgroup">
  238. <input type="image" name="submit" src="images/save.png" value="Opslaan" title="opslaan"/>
  239.  
  240. </div>
  241. </form>
  242. </body>
  243. </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ement